Care by Volvo has been discontinued in Germany: what are the alternatives?
Volvo Cars discontinued its own car subscription model, Care by Volvo, for new customers in Germany at the end of 2024. Existing customers were able to let their contracts expire; new contracts are no longer offered through official Volvo dealerships. For Volvo car subscriptions in Germany, MHC Mobility remains a key option as a multi-brand B2B provider.
Unlike Care by Volvo, the MHC Mobility car subscription service is multi-brand and offers Volvo alongside more than 20 other brands under a single contract model. This allows companies to bundle a Volvo XC60 for field service, a Mercedes Sprinter for logistics, and a Tesla for executive use under a single contract. The monthly rates are calculated on a brand-neutral basis.

Tax Benefits of a Volvo as a Company Car
The monthly payment for a Volvo car subscription is generally treated for business purposes as business expense is deducted and reduces taxable income. If a Volvo company car is also used for personal purposes, different rules apply depending on the type of powertrain.
The Volvo XC60 plug-in hybrid is taxed as a taxable benefit equal to 0.5 percent of the gross list price when used as a private company car, provided that the electric range is at least 80 kilometers or the CO2 emissions do not exceed 50 grams per kilometer. That is half the rate that would apply to a comparable internal combustion engine vehicle.
Fully electric Volvo models are taxed at a rate of only 0.25 percent of the gross list price, provided that the gross list price does not exceed 100,000 euros. This limit was raised from 70,000 euros to 100,000 euros effective July 1, 2025 (Section 6(1)(4) of the Income Tax Act). If the gross list price exceeds 100,000 euros, the 0.5 percent rule applies.
Purely electric vehicles are also exempt from motor vehicle tax until December 31, 2030, provided the vehicle was first registered by December 31, 2025. The individual tax classification should be agreed with the tax consultant.
